Nephi, UT carries a PlainCrime A safety grade with violent crime 61% below the U.S. average
According to the FBI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program for 2024, Nephi, UT shows violent crime at 136 per 100,000 residents and property crime at 734.4 per 100,000. Violent crime runs 61% below the U.S. average. PlainCrime assigns grade A from those rates. Figures are voluntary agency submissions joined to population denominators; incomplete coverage can move the number.

What the 2024 FBI UCR record shows for Nephi, UT
2020–2024 direction
The reported violent-crime rate ended the window higher
Across 5 comparable reporting years, the rate moved from 61.6 per 100,000 in 2020 to 136.0 in 2024 (+120.9%). The highest observed value was 197.0 in 2021 and the lowest 61.6 in 2020. Years whose submission failed the completeness test are left out of this comparison rather than plotted as change.
Small-count caution
The violent-crime count is small enough that the derived rate is unstable
Nephi reported 10 violent offences in 2024 against a population of 7,353. At this volume one additional or one fewer report moves the per-100,000 rate noticeably, so the figure is better read as a data point than as a precise measurement, and year-to-year swings here are expected.
Comparable rate records
Nephi's closest reported-rate comparisons are in the Utah cohort
The nearest comparable 2024 records to Nephi's 136.0 violent-crime rate per 100,000 are Logan (137.3), Layton (129.7), Payson (127.7), South Ogden (146.6). These are same-year agency submissions that pass the same completeness screen, not a claim that the cities have identical conditions. They make the cohort position above checkable against named records instead of a generic state average.
Position in the state cohort
Nephi sits mid-pack among comparable Utah cities
At 136.0 reported violent offenses per 100,000 residents in 2024, Nephi ranks 40 of 77 — above 37 of the 76 other Utah cities whose 2024 submission passes this site’s completeness test. That is -4.2% against the cohort median of 141.9. Cities that did not report, or that reported implausibly low totals, are excluded from this cohort rather than counted as low-crime.

Reporting Agency
Nephi Police Department NIBRS-participating
Nephi's crime figures on this page originate from Nephi Police Department's submission to the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ting Program.
This agency reports via NIBRS, the incident-based system that captures more detail per offense (multiple crimes per incident, victim/offender data) than the older summary counts.
